Sim

Fehlerbehebung

Häufige Probleme und Lösungen

Datenbankverbindung fehlgeschlagen

# Check database is running
docker compose ps db

# Test connection
docker compose exec db psql -U postgres -c "SELECT 1"

Überprüfen Sie das DATABASE_URL Format: postgresql://user:pass@host:5432/database

Ollama-Modelle werden nicht angezeigt

In Docker ist localhost = der Container, nicht Ihr Host-Rechner.

# For host-machine Ollama, use:
OLLAMA_URL=http://host.docker.internal:11434  # macOS/Windows
OLLAMA_URL=http://192.168.1.x:11434           # Linux (use actual IP)

WebSocket/Echtzeit funktioniert nicht

  1. Prüfen Sie, ob NEXT_PUBLIC_SOCKET_URL mit Ihrer Domain übereinstimmt
  2. Überprüfen Sie, ob der Echtzeit-Dienst läuft: docker compose ps realtime
  3. Stellen Sie sicher, dass der Reverse-Proxy WebSocket-Upgrades weiterleitet (siehe Docker-Anleitung)

502 Bad Gateway

# Check app is running
docker compose ps simstudio
docker compose logs simstudio

# Common causes: out of memory, database not ready

Migrationsfehler

# View migration logs
docker compose logs migrations

# Run manually
docker compose exec simstudio bun run db:migrate

pgvector nicht gefunden

Verwenden Sie das richtige PostgreSQL-Image:

image: pgvector/pgvector:pg17  # NOT postgres:17

Zertifikatsfehler (CERT_HAS_EXPIRED)

Wenn Sie SSL-Zertifikatsfehler beim Aufrufen externer APIs sehen:

# Update CA certificates in container
docker compose exec simstudio apt-get update && apt-get install -y ca-certificates

# Or set in environment (not recommended for production)
NODE_TLS_REJECT_UNAUTHORIZED=0

Leere Seite nach dem Login

  1. Überprüfen Sie die Browser-Konsole auf Fehler
  2. Stellen Sie sicher, dass NEXT_PUBLIC_APP_URL mit Ihrer tatsächlichen Domain übereinstimmt
  3. Löschen Sie Browser-Cookies und lokalen Speicher
  4. Prüfen Sie, ob alle Dienste laufen: docker compose ps

Windows-spezifische Probleme

Turbopack-Fehler unter Windows:

# Use WSL2 for better compatibility
wsl --install

# Or disable Turbopack in package.json
# Change "next dev --turbopack" to "next dev"

Zeilenende-Probleme:

# Configure git to use LF
git config --global core.autocrlf input

Logs anzeigen

# All services
docker compose logs -f

# Specific service
docker compose logs -f simstudio

Hilfe erhalten

On this page

On this page

Start building today
Trusted by over 60,000 builders.
Build Agentic workflows visually on a drag-and-drop canvas or with natural language.
Get started